Braves vs. Phillies: Betting Preview for August 22

Published 4:24 am Thursday, August 22, 2024

Marcell Ozuna and the Atlanta Braves (67-59) will host Alec Bohm and the Philadelphia Phillies (74-52) at Truist Park on Thursday, August 22, with a start time of 7:08 p.m. ET.

At -110, the Phillies are the moneyline underdogs in this game versus the Braves, who are listed at -110. This matchup’s over/under has been set at 8. You can get -120 odds on the over and +100 odds on the under.

Braves Probable Starting Pitcher

  • Spencer Schwellenbach makes the start for the Braves, his 14th of the season. He is 4-6 with a 4.04 ERA and 85 strikeouts in 75 2/3 innings pitched.
  • In his last appearance on Saturday against the Los Angeles Angels, the right-hander threw five innings, giving up three earned runs while surrendering four hits.
  • Schwellenbach is trying to secure his eighth quality start of the year in this matchup.
  • Schwellenbach is aiming for his 12th straight appearance lasting five or more innings. He averages 5.8 innings per appearance on the mound.
  • He has made one appearance this season in which he did not give up an earned run.

Braves Hitting & Pitching Performance

  • The Braves rank fourth-best in MLB action with 165 total home runs.
  • Atlanta’s .413 slugging percentage is 12th in baseball.
  • The Braves are 17th in MLB with a .241 batting average.
  • Atlanta is the 16th-highest scoring team in baseball, averaging 4.3 runs per game (542 total).
  • The Braves’ .307 on-base percentage ranks 20th in baseball.
  • The Braves strike out 9.1 times per game to rank 24th in baseball.
  • Atlanta has the second-ranked team ERA across all MLB pitching staffs (3.69).
  • Atlanta’s pitching staff is first in the majors with a collective 9.6 strikeouts per nine innings.
  • Pitchers for the Braves combine for the No. 8-ranked WHIP in the majors (1.226).
